  • PHS Mission

    Princeton School is committed to providing a community for learning that is ever-evolving. We will empower all students to value learning, discover their talents, and experience life-long successes, individually and corporately worldwide.

    Classroom Principles

    Fairness

    We will strive to:

    Exercise fairness in all interactions with classmates, teachers, staff, administration and visitors.

    Be fair in efforts to achieve the expectations set for us by ourselves, the teacher and administration.

    Treat others as you would like to be treated.   

    Honesty and Integrity

    We will:

    Be truthful in all interactions with classmates, teachers,  staff, administration and visitors.

    Strive to conduct ourselves in a manner that will merit the respect of classmates, teachers,  staff, administration and visitors.

    Commitment to Excellence

    We will strive to:

    Provide high-quality products and assignments in an efficient manner.

    Deliver the best possible experience in this classroom for classmates, teachers,  staff, administration and visitors.

    Positive Attitude

    We will strive to:

    Emphasize the positives in all interactions with classmates, teachers,  staff, administration and visitors.

    Approach every task in a “can-do,” positive manner with energy and enthusiasm.

    Respect

    We will strive to:

    Maintain genuine concern for fellow classmates, teachers,  staff, administration and visitors.

    Recognize and respect all classmates, teachers,  staff, administration and visitors as an individual.

    Faith

    We will strive to:

    Maintain confidence in our abilities as individuals to fulfill our assigned task and responsibilities.

    Trust in the capabilities of our classmates, teachers,  staff, administration and visitors.

    Have confidence that the strength of our combined, collaborative efforts will lead us to fulfill our objectives and goals.

    Perseverance

    We will strive to:

    Continue to work toward our goals and objectives in spite of obstacles and in a manner consistent with our Classroom Principles
